Description

An exceptional family home occupying a cul-de-sac position in the sought-after Lower Preston area.

Mortimer Avenue offers a tucked away position yet within close proximity to the local amenities at Preston which include an excellent range of day-to-day shops and mini supermarkets, takeaways, public houses, surgeries, Preston Beach and seafront. Preston is also on the main number 12 bus route linking Paignton town, Brixham, Torquay and Newton Abbot.

Approached from the road there is a concrete driveway providing off-road parking for several vehicles and access to the side leading to work room/potential home office (currently used as a dog grooming salon) and pathway leading to the front door. Once inside, an entrance porch opens into the spacious reception hallway and leads to the ground floor accommodation which comprises a sitting room with bay window to the front aspect, family room with double doors opening onto the garden, contemporary kitchen/diner with large central island and full-length breakfast bar, a utility and WC. On the first floor, the landing leads to four bedrooms and a four-piece bathroom/WC. The property also has double glazed windows and doors and gas central heating. A particular feature of the property is the large rear garden which offers a level and enclosed space, with a large patio accessed from the family room and kitchen diner, a large lawned area bordered by a stream with a bridge leading over to a raised deck seating area. To the side are multiple storage sheds, a timber-built bar and socialising area and a gated side access.
